Discussion Question 1Using the Online Library or the Internet, research atomic nuclear decay. On the basis of your research, respond to the following:Why and how does atomic nuclear decay take place? Explain, being sure to address different types of decay.
Atomic nuclear decay occurs when there is radioactive decay of the nucleus of a radioactive and unstable atom where there is the emission of radiation in the form of energy. A radioactive atom becomes more stable when then an unstable nuclide decays and in the process there is radiation (Ball & Key, 2018). The process takes place when a parent nuclide or isotope decays or disintegrates into a daughter nuclide and if the daughter nuclide is still unstable there is further disintegration. The number of protons and neutrons is considered when classifying the atoms. The nucleus may change into one or more elements. Radiation emitted is in three different classes the alpha, beta and gamma. Alpha radiation (α) is made up of nuclei of the helium -4 isotope (two protons and two neutrons) being emitted. Beta (β) radiation is made up of electron emission. Gamma radiation (γ) is electromagnetic in nature where there is an emission of high-energy radiation.
What is the significance of atomic nuclear decay? (How is it used to our advantage?)
Radioactivity or radiation in atomic nuclear decay is used on medicine to diagnose and treat diseases and in nuclear energy. Radiation therapies including x rays are common medical procedures that also have therapeutic uses. Nuclear energy is that obtained by the fusion or fission of atomic nuclei, that is, the central part of an atom. Atoms are the smallest elements that can be divided and their nucleus is made up of protons and neutrons.
